Ingredients
- 1 cup ground dark roast coffee
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ar
- 2 teaspoons ground cinnamon
- ½ teaspoon ground nutmeg
- ½ teaspoon ground cloves
- 8 cups water
- Whipped cream, for topping (optional)
Making Your Perfect Christmas Coffee

Prepare the Coffee Filter
First, add the ground coffee to a paper coffee filter and set it aside. This step ensures that the coffee is perfectly brewed without any gritty residues.
Whisk Together the Spices
In a small bowl, whisk together the brown sugar, ground cinnamon, nutmeg, and ground cloves until well combined. This blend of spices is what will give your coffee that festive flavor profile.
Combine Coffee and Spice Mixture
Add the spice mixture to the ground coffee in the filter. Mixing these warm spices with the coffee ensures that every sip of your Christmas coffee is filled with the rich aromas of the season.
Brew the Coffee
Prepare the coffee according to the instructions of your coffee maker. Whether you’re using a drip coffee maker, a French press, or a pour-over, the key is to let those spices steep and infuse into the brew.
Serve and Enjoy
Pour the freshly brewed coffee into mugs. Top with a generous dollop of whipped cream, and for an extra festive touch, sprinkle some cinnamon on top.

Tips for Success
- For an even more indulgent treat, consider adding a splash of vanilla extract to the coffee before brewing.
- Adjust the spice levels based on your personal preference. If you love nutmeg, feel free to add a little more!
Variations
- Try using flavored creamers like hazelnut or vanilla for a different twist.
- For a non-coffee drink, substitute brewed coffee with hot cocoa and use the same spice blend.
Storage Tips
If you have leftovers, store the brewed coffee in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. Reheat as needed, but be aware that the flavors may mellow.

FAQs
Q: Can I make this coffee ahead of time?
A: Yes, you can brew the coffee and keep it warm in a thermal carafe for a few hours.
Q: Is there a way to make this coffee decaffeinated?
A: Absolutely! Just use decaffeinated ground coffee in the recipe.
Q: Can I add alcohol to this coffee?
A: Yes! A splash of Irish cream, Kahlúa, or spiced rum makes for a delightful adult version.
Q: How can I make this recipe vegan?
A: Simply omit the whipped cream or use a vegan alternative made from coconut or almond milk.
Q: What if I don’t have all the spices?
A: You can get creative by using store-bought chai spices or pumpkin pie spice as a substitute.
